Idea's youth Turkey Hunt
 
I am having 3 youth turkey hunters on my lease in Ohio this weekend.

I have 2 blinds

1 ASAT(If it shows up before Saturday)
2 Double Bull Blind

I am going to keep two youngest with me, and a Dad and his son in the other.

How do others work it with 2 hunters in the blind?

Alternate shots? First Turkey goes to hunter A, if hunter A does not get shot. Than next Turkey goes to hunter B. Just alternate until you score one?

How do you guys work with multiple hunters in the blind?

in a case like that i would sit in the middle. anything from the left is the kids on the left. anything on the right is the kids on the right. if more than 1 bird comes in the left shoots left and right shoots right on a 1,2,3 boom! count. it will be tough...one might get upset when the other shoots and the other goes birdless...but thats hunting. keep hunting and try to get the other one a bird. its important they know the rules though so they both dont clober 1 bird and fight over it or something...and to keep them safe, not shooting across anyone...
